java - QuickFIX/J 如何禁用自动登录响应

标签 java quickfix

我想在收到 LOGON 消息后执行一些操作,然后决定 LOGON 是否失败(例如检查用户名和密码)但是... 收到 LOGON 消息后,QuickFIX/J 立即重新发送:

8=FIX.4.4|9=74|35=A|34=13|49=FIXserver|52=20110831-09:27:41.847|56=localhost|98=0|108=10|10=131|
8=FIX.4.4|9=71|35=2|34=14|49=FIXserver|52=20110831-09:27:41.855|56=localhost|7=1|16=0|10=213|

如何禁用此功能?

第二个问题。如果 LOGON 失败,我应该重新发送 LOGOUT 消息还是其他消息?

最佳答案

调用您所需的方法来执行登录 checkin 和 onLogon 中的其他检查。您可以在 toAdmin 中禁用发送消息。消息的入口点是fromAdmin,发送点是toAdmin

由于未登录,因此无需发送注销消息。仅当您已登录时才可以注销 session 。

关于java - QuickFIX/J 如何禁用自动登录响应,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7255166/

相关文章:

java - 在 linux 中用 java 打印

QuickFIX - 设置开始时间\结束时间

python - 如何在 QuickFix 中获取 SessionID

java - 如何使用 Preloader 重新启动 JavaFX 中的应用程序?

java - 在 Eclipse 中快速修复 JSP?

c# - QuickFix 登录问题

c++ - NodeJS Wrapped C++ 代码的函数故障是如何传播的?

Java反编译->重新编译的过程,安全吗?

java - 为什么方法 Queue#add() 有 boolean 值返回值?

java - Cassandra Spark Connector JavaDemo 编译错误